Understanding Local Pest Dynamics
Bakersfield homeowners face a range of pest challenges, including:
| Common Pest | Description |
|---|---|
| Ants | Argentine and harvester ants thrive in our dry climate |
| Rodents | Mice and rats seek shelter from extreme temperatures |
| Cockroaches | Our warm environment is ideal for these resilient insects |
| Termites | Wood-destroying pests that can compromise home foundations |
Comprehensive Strategies to Stop Pest Infestations
1. Seal Entry Points: Your First Line of Defense
Thorough home inspection is crucial. Carefully examine your home’s exterior for potential entry points:
- Foundation cracks: Even tiny fissures can invite pests
- Window and door gaps: Install weatherstripping and repair damaged screens
- Utility line penetrations: Seal around pipes, electrical conduits, and cable lines
Tip: Use steel wool, caulk, or expanding foam to block potential entry routes.
2. Maintain Impeccable Home Sanitation
Pests are attracted to food, moisture, and clutter. Implement these strategies:
| Area | Prevention Tactics |
|---|---|
| Kitchen | Store food in sealed containers, clean spills immediately, take out trash regularly |
| Bathroom | Fix leaky pipes, use exhaust fans, keep areas dry |
| Garage & Storage | Minimize cardboard storage, use plastic bins with tight lids, keep areas clean and organized |
3. Landscape Management: Create a Pest-Resistant Perimeter
Your yard can be a breeding ground or a barrier against pests:
- Trim vegetation away from home exterior
- Remove standing water that attracts mosquitoes
- Keep firewood at least 20 feet from your home
- Use gravel or rock barriers around foundation

Eco-Friendly Pest Prevention Techniques
Modern homeowners prioritize environmentally responsible solutions. Use natural repellents like peppermint oil and vinegar solutions, diatomaceous earth for non-toxic insect control, beneficial nematodes for garden pest management, and encourage natural predators such as birds and beneficial insects.

When to Call the Professionals
Warning Signs You Need Immediate Pest Control:
- Visible pest trails or nests
- Unexplained property damage
- Unusual sounds in walls or attic
- Allergic reactions or unexplained bites
- Droppings or gnaw marks
